Cloruro de paladio(II)

PdCl₂

IUPAC: Palladium(II) chloride

CAS: 7647-10-1

Descripción general

Palladium(II) chloride is a key starting material for palladium catalysts used in cross-coupling reactions that won the 2010 Nobel Prize in Chemistry.

Usos

  • Cross-coupling catalyst precursor
  • CO detector
  • Photography
  • Electrochemistry
